Best Morgan Hill Private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there are 9 private schools serving 1,722 students in Morgan Hill, CA (there are 11 public schools, serving 6,965 public students). 20% of all K-12 students in Morgan Hill, CA are educated in private schools (compared to the CA state average of 10%).
The top ranked private schools in Morgan Hill, CA include Oakwood and St. Catherine Catholic School.
44% of private schools in Morgan Hill, CA are religiously affiliated (most commonly Catholic and Assembly of God).
